aboutsummaryrefslogtreecommitdiff
path: root/tools/perf/scripts/python/export-to-sqlite.py
diff options
context:
space:
mode:
authorKent Overstreet <[email protected]>2022-11-13 22:43:37 -0500
committerKent Overstreet <[email protected]>2023-10-22 17:09:46 -0400
commit6b1b186a5a8e9cf4770e9546c3606fef40666830 (patch)
tree7bb738a19abf55c07d065c14d4179a5ba5fcf883 /tools/perf/scripts/python/export-to-sqlite.py
parent84fea8e5b3abc9147a20211e608ba8844c479998 (diff)
bcachefs: Minor dio write path improvements
This switches where we take quota reservations to be per bch_wirte_op instead of per dio_write, so we can drop the quota reservation in the same place as we call i_sectors_acct(), and only take/release ei_quota_lock once. In the future we'd like ei_quota_lock to not be a mutex, so that we can avoid punting to process context before deliving write completions in nocow mode. Signed-off-by: Kent Overstreet <[email protected]>
Diffstat (limited to 'tools/perf/scripts/python/export-to-sqlite.py')
0 files changed, 0 insertions, 0 deletions